Output 504bbd20ffa648e8815a5c126572a0e7a9e95816db41bbf91d43254a0ff4cd02:3

value
32983688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32a1a4f1952747d6b3ae2cae0a59d98226c09fa7 OP_EQUAL
address
36JjMNvw6avb6Gpx8iZZnEpWXwNkoMpggM
transaction
504bbd20ffa648e8815a5c126572a0e7a9e95816db41bbf91d43254a0ff4cd02
spent
true